Key Features and Benefits of the Sony DSC-W330

  • 14.1MP Effective Still Resolution: Enjoy high-quality images with vibrant colors and sharp details, thanks to the 14.1-megapixel CCD sensor. Perfect for enlarging prints or sharing online.
  • 4x Optical Zoom Lens: The 26mm Carl Zeiss Vario-Tessar lens with up to 105mm maximum focal length allows for stunning close-ups without sacrificing image quality.
  • 3-Inch LCD Display: The fixed 230,400-dot screen offers a clear view of your subjects, making framing your shots effortless.
  • Image Stabilization: Integrated digital image stabilization helps reduce blur, allowing for sharper images even in challenging lighting conditions.
  • Movie Mode: Capture high-quality video with the ability to record in MJPEG format, ensuring your most cherished moments are kept in motion.
  • Shooting Modes: Choose from various scene settings, including automatic options, to adapt to any environment, making your photography experience smoother.
  • Easy Connectivity: With USB connectivity, transferring your images and videos to other devices is quick and convenient.
  • Lightweight and Portable: Weighing just 0.28 pounds, the ultracompact design makes it easy to slip into a pocket or bag, ideal for travel.

  2. JB

    We had a Sony camera for several years that finally gave up the ghost, and thought this model would make a good replacement. Unlike the prior model, it offers virtually no user control. Worst of all, there is a considerable delay between pushing the shutter button and the picture being taken, resulting in lots of lost shots. There’s apparently no way to adjust for bright backgrounds, so beach and snow shots are not really possible. Pictures come out dark, and due to the delay, often blurred. We bought one for our son and his wife, and the same issues show up in their photos. The display is good though…..

  5. Ann

    I went by the ratings and also word of mouth before buying this camera and I actually bought 2 cameras… one Panasonic Lumix 12 MP and this Sony 14.1 MP. Upon first site, the Panasonic appears to be built better. The buttons were larger and the camera was a little heavier. I thought, for sure, I’d keep the Panasonic. Well, after trying both of them simultaneously the Sony took better pictures. The Sony has a Carl Zeiss lense which is a very good lense. Of course, all cameras have brightness adjustments, etc, but the Sony knew when to let more light in when there was not enough light (great for dim light pics). I’m sure the Panasonic could do the same if you want to keep adjusting the lighting, but I want a camera that is going to take great pics with pointing and shooting and this camera does just that. The reason the imaging takes longer to see clearly on the LCD when you go back to view pics, I would assume, is because it is a 14.1 Mega Pixel (a lot of information) at a great price so it takes a 1/4 sec to focus the pic in clearly! I don’t mind it. I’d rather have great pics when transporting them onto a computer, viewing them on the computer or TV or printing them. Also, when you go into a photo editor, the clarity is scary. You can see every little detail. If you want to spend another $30 there’s also the Sony W350, which will allow for viewing high def videos on your high def TV, but I viewed a video I took with the W330 and the clarity is still great.
